The Ningbo Lishe International Airport, located in East China's Zhejiang province, is about 12 kilometers from downtown Ningbo, or a 20 minute drive.

The airport's Terminal 2, which is 2.5 times larger than Terminal 1, began operating at the end of 2019 with a 3,200-meter-long taxiway, a 112,400 square-meter terminal tower, and 60 aircraft stands.

The new terminal, which is equipped with advanced communication and navigation control equipment, meets 4E class standards and can accommodate large aircraft such as the Boeing 747.

Metro line 2 is the most convenient and economical way to get to the new terminal.

In 2019, the airport's passenger throughput stood at 12.414 million, while freight throughput reached 106,000 metric tons. The airport served a daily average of 240 flights operated by 50 airlines.

As of the end of 2019, it was offering a total of 143 flights, including 15 international ones.

There are regular flights to many Chinese cities/regions, including Beijing, Shanghai, Guangzhou, Shenyang, Xi'an, Xiamen, Shenzhen, Nanjing, Kunming, Chengdu, Urumqi, Hong Kong, Macao, and Taiwan, as well as international cities such as Fukuoka, Osaka, and Nagoya in Japan; Incheon and Cheju in South Korea, and Bangkok, capital of Thailand. 

By 2030, the airport hopes to increase passenger and cargo throughput to 30 million and 500,000 metric tons, respectively.
